What is BA or BSc Psychology (Honours)?

Psychology (Honours) is a 3-year undergraduate programme split into 6 semesters. BA offers more arts electives while BSc includes lab-based papers. Both require Psychology as the main subject with supporting papers in Sociology, Statistics, Philosophy, Biology or Mathematics. Eligibility is 10+2 with at least 45% aggregate; many colleges reserve 50% seats for women. The curriculum covers cognitive psychology, social psychology, psychopathology and research methods. Practical papers include lab work, internships and dissertations.

Psychology honours syllabus: what you will study

The core curriculum is set by UGC and followed by all colleges. Year 1: Introduction to Psychology, Statistics, Social Psychology, English. Year 2: Cognitive Psychology, Developmental Psychology, Psychopathology, Research Methods. Year 3: Industrial Psychology, Counselling Psychology, Psychological Testing, Dissertation. Practical papers include lab experiments, SPSS-based data analysis and 6-week internships in hospitals, NGOs or corporate HR. Electives include Forensic Psychology, Sports Psychology or Health Psychology.

Psychology honours vs general psychology: key differences

  • Honours: 18–20 papers in Psychology, 60% core, 40% electives; mandatory dissertation; limited seats (30–60).
  • General: 6–8 papers in Psychology; open electives from other streams; no dissertation; seats are 100–200.
  • Eligibility: Honours needs 45–50% in Class 12; general needs 40% and no subject restriction.
  • Career: Honours is preferred for clinical/counselling roles and higher studies; general suits allied careers like HR, marketing.

Can I do psychology honours if I studied science in 12th?

Yes. BSc Psychology (Honours) is designed for science stream students. You need Biology or Mathematics as a subject; some colleges accept Physical Education or Psychology itself. If you have PCM, you can still apply but may need to take additional bridge courses in Biology. Christ University and Loyola College explicitly welcome science background candidates.

Psychology honours vs B.A. Psychology: which is better?

  • BA Psychology: Broader liberal arts base, easier to pair with Economics/Political Science, good for HR, media, civil services.
  • BSc Psychology: Stronger research orientation, mandatory lab papers, preferred for clinical roles and MSc admissions in science universities.
  • Cut-offs: BA cut-offs are 1–2% lower than BSc in the same college.
  • Salary: BSc graduates command ₹0.5–₹1 LPA higher starting salary in clinical/HR roles.
